#include#includeintmain(){intthis_sum,max_sum,old_first,old_last,new_first;intn,i,tmp,flag=1;intfirst=1;int*data;scanf("%d",&n);this_sum=max_sum=old_first=new_first=0;old_last=n-1;data=(int*)malloc(n*sizeof(int)
系統 2019-08-12 01:32:46 1933
我介紹了原創企業級控件庫之大數據據量分頁控件,這個控件主要是通過存儲過程進行數據分頁,得到了大家的支持,也給出了許多寶貴的建議,在這兒先感謝各位。同時也讓我更有信心進行以后的文章(企業級控件庫系列)。分頁對于每個項目來說都有它存在的意義,想起在以前剛剛剛軟件開發時,由于剛剛畢業,理論知識雄厚,但實際工作經驗欠缺,記得幾年前做開發時,數據量很大,要用分頁,一開始真不知道如何是好,方法到知道,但速度與穩定性卻沒有經驗。在這兒,我只是起到一個拋磚引玉的作用,以便
系統 2019-08-12 01:52:44 1932
原文:將表里的數據批量生成INSERT語句的存儲過程增強版將表里的數據批量生成INSERT語句的存儲過程增強版有時候,我們需要將某個表里的數據全部或者根據查詢條件導出來,遷移到另一個相同結構的庫中目前SQLServer里面是沒有相關的工具根據查詢條件來生成INSERT語句的,只有借助第三方工具(thirdpartytools)這種腳本網上也有很多,但是網上的腳本還是欠缺一些規范和功能,例如:我只想導出特定查詢條件的數據,網上的腳本都是導出全表數據如果表很大
系統 2019-08-12 01:51:28 1932
本文轉自:http://hi.baidu.com/wlw7758/blog/item/f6b0b9110d2a097aca80c4e4.html我們在編寫MIS系統和Web應用程序等系統時,都涉及到與數據庫的交互,如果數據庫中數據量很大的話,一次檢索所有的記錄,會占用系統很大的資源,因此我們常常采用,需要多少數據就只從數據庫中取多少條記錄,即采用分頁語句。根據自己使用過的內容,把常見數據庫SqlServer,Oracle和Mysql的分頁語句,從數據庫表中
系統 2019-08-12 01:55:27 1931
insertintoInfoselect'admin36'fromInfo;--FK插入法selectCOUNT(*)fromInfo;--notin實現分頁查詢declare@pageSizeintset@pageSize=10;--行數declare@pageNointset@pageNo=1000;--頁數selecttop(10)*fromInfowhereidnotin(selecttop(@pageSize*(@pageNo-1))idfrom
系統 2019-08-12 01:55:23 1931
咱花一個下午給自己歸納了下字符編碼知識==,在腦子里理理順當~ASCII:早期的字符集,7位,128個字符,包括大小寫a-z字母,0-9數字以及一些控制字符.擴展ASCII:1個字節8位,只用7位不合理.于是第8位用于擴展ASCII字符集,這樣就又多了128個字符.于是用著后128個字符來擴展表示如拉丁字母,希臘字母等特殊符號.但問題是歐洲那一票國家很多互相都擁有不相同的特殊字母,一起塞進后128個明顯不夠,于是代碼頁出現了.CodePage(代碼頁):1
系統 2019-08-12 01:53:03 1931
與之前使用的方法一樣,可以從一個可變的位圖對象構造Canvas對象。為了創建一個可變的位圖對象,即可以修改的位圖對象,必須提供寬度、高度和配置。配置通常是在Bitmap.Config類中定義的一個常量值。一下代碼創建了一個可變的位圖對象,指定顯示為寬度和高度的尺寸,并且將Bitmap.Config.ARGB_8888常量作為配置使用。1Bitmapbitmap=Bitmap.createBitmap((int)getWindowManager().getD
系統 2019-08-12 01:52:17 1931
SQL經典面試題及答案轉自:http://hi.baidu.com/pei_ji_xiang/item/3838b637165c8121b3c0c5ee1.一道SQL語句面試題,關于groupby表內容:2005-05-09勝2005-05-09勝2005-05-09負2005-05-09負2005-05-10勝2005-05-10負2005-05-10負如果要生成下列結果,該如何寫sql語句?勝負2005-05-09222005-05-1012-----
系統 2019-08-12 01:51:53 1931
OWIN產生的背景以及簡單介紹隨著VS2013的發布,微軟在Asp.Net中引入了很多新的特性,比如使用新的權限驗證模塊Identity,使用Async來提高Web服務器的吞吐量和效率等。其中一個不得不提的是OWIN和Katana.OWIN的全稱是OpenWebInterfaceFor.Net,OWIN是.Net開源社區借鑒Ruby而制定的.NetWeb開發架構,有著非常簡單的規范定義,同時極度降低了模塊間耦合。OWIN并不是一個具體的實現,而只是一個規范
系統 2019-08-12 01:54:27 1930
一次過,鏈表題無難度1/**2*Definitionforsingly-linkedlist.3*structListNode{4*intval;5*ListNode*next;6*ListNode(intx):val(x),next(NULL){}7*};8*/9classSolution{10public:11ListNode*partition(ListNode*head,intx){12//StarttypingyourC/C++solutionb
系統 2019-08-12 01:53:50 1930
使用遠程桌面鏈接登錄到終端服務器時經常會遇到“終端服務器超出最大允許鏈接數”諸如此類錯誤導致無法正常登錄終端服務器,引起該問題的原因在于終端服務的缺省鏈接數為2個鏈接,并且當登錄遠程桌面后如果不是采用注銷方式退出,而是直接關閉遠程桌面窗口,那么實際上會話并沒有釋放掉,而是繼續保留在服務器端,這樣就會占用總的鏈接數,當這個數量達到最大允許值時就會出現上面的提示。解決方式:一、用注銷來退出遠程桌面而不是直接關閉窗口二、限制已斷開鏈接的會話存在時間三、增加最多鏈
系統 2019-08-12 01:53:34 1930
在項目開發中,有時會通過本地的oracle來操作遠程數據庫的表,那么,就需要用到oracle的DBLink技術。創建DBlink步驟如下:一、獲取遠程數據庫的GLOBAL_NAME:SELECT*FROMGLOBAL_NAME;二、檢查oracle版本是否支持同步功能:select*fromv$optionwherePARAMETER='Advancedreplication',如果返回True,則表示支持,否則,就是不支持,本地和遠程數據庫都必須為支持才
系統 2019-08-12 01:53:25 1930
運行DCOMCNFG具體配置方法如下:1:在服務器上安裝office的Excel軟件.2:在"開始"->"運行"中輸入dcomcnfg.exe啟動"組件服務"3:依次雙擊"組件服務"->"計算機"->"我的電腦"->"DCOM配置"4:在"DCOM配置"中找到"MicrosoftExcel應用程序",在它上面點擊右鍵,然后點擊"屬性",彈出"MicrosoftExcel應用程序屬性"對話框5:點擊"標識"標簽,選擇"交互式用戶"6:點擊"安全"標簽,在"啟
系統 2019-08-12 01:52:17 1930
這幾年,大大小小的做過十來個項目,軟件做好了,怎樣告訴別人你的工作成果呢?我的經驗適合于公司內部項目,不適合向外發布的面對像上帝一樣的客戶的項目。有幾個項目是公司內部項目,雖然大家平時溝通的郵件都是英語來,英語去的,但是一專業起來,用英語寫出新版本發布說明,人家還真不愿意看,一方面自己英語不好,不能做到通俗易懂,另一方面大家做事都講究效率,通常只有boss的郵件,大家才會被迫用金山詞霸一個個仔細看,對于title太小的(比如我們程序員)職員,通常是直接打電
系統 2019-08-12 01:33:01 1930
-------在SQLserver2000中測試--查詢所有用戶表所有字段的特征SELECTD.NameasTableName,A.colorderASColOrder,A.nameASName,COLUMNPROPERTY(A.ID,A.Name,'IsIdentity')ASIsIdentity,CASEWHENEXISTS(SELECT1FROMdbo.sysobjectsWHEREXtype='PK'ANDNameIN(SELECTNameFROM
系統 2019-08-12 01:32:19 1930